CloudLand

Cloudland, a light weight infrastructure as a service project, plus OpenShift 4 platform as a service deployment engine, is a system framework to manage VM instances, software defined networks (SDN), volumes ..., It can handle over 10 thousand hypervisors in one cluster so it can be a base of large scale public cloud. More over, with multi-tenant and OpenShift 4 cluster deployments on demand, it can be a straightforward alternative for private cloud or as a hyper converged infrastructure (HCI) solution.

Cloudland's main distinguishing features are:

  • Able to deploy OpenShift 4 cluster on demand per tenant
  • Compatibility with Openstack API (TBD)
  • Light weight, no tons of components
  • Flat learning curve for both developers and operators
  • Excellent performance for inside messages delivery
  • Based on HPC architecture, so super scalable
  • Self auto fail recovery and stable
  • Easy to customize to implement your own feature

Architecture overview


To support ultra-large scale, the hypervisors are organized into a tree hierarchy, the agents (scia are launched on demand)
